Job Description

Were seeking a motivated Real Estate & Easement Coordinator to join a growing real estate and infrastructure support team. This position is ideal for professionals with a strong background in property documentation, title review, and land transactions especially those who have managed service easements, permits, or rights-of-way .

This is a dynamic role where youll combine administrative precision, property knowledge, and stakeholder coordination to help ensure smooth and compliant easement transactions.

Key Responsibilities

Service Easement Management

  • Manage all internal and external aspects of the Service Easement process from start to completion.
  • Review Real Estate Action Requests related to Service Easements.
  • Perform title and Service Easement exhibit reviews to ensure completeness and accuracy.
  • Conduct site visits when necessary to verify property conditions or easement locations.
  • Prepare and distribute Service Easement Forms and Packages to applicants.
  • Serve as the primary liaison between internal departments (Technicians, Legal, CRET) and external stakeholders (applicants, property owners, county and municipal officials).
  • Review and record completed easement documentation in accordance with company procedures and regulatory requirements.
  • Manage all administrative aspects of each transaction in Tririga from file creation through submission and final approval.
  • Report on transaction progress during bi-weekly team meetings .
  • Maintain an organized, up-to-date portfolio of Service Easement projects , managing each independently.
  • Support other transactions within the broader Corporate Real Estate & Transactions (CRET) portfolio as needed.

Real Estate Coordination Support

  • Conduct property and title research to confirm ownership and boundary details.
  • Draft, review, and track contracts, leases, licenses, and right-of-entry agreements as assigned.
  • Collaborate with title and project teams to resolve any curative or documentation issues.
  • Maintain internal databases and project schedules with up-to-date property data and status notes.
  • Prepare reports, meeting materials, and correspondence for project stakeholders.

Who You Are

  • 2+ years of experience in real estate coordination, title review, or easement management .
  • Strong understanding of property records, deeds, maps, and title documentation .
  • Comfortable liaising with public officials, landowners, and legal professionals .
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ook) ; experience with Tririga, Adobe, or SharePoint is a plus.
  • Excellent communicator with attention to detail and organizational accuracy .
  • Self-motivated, able to work independently while staying connected to the team.
  • Bachelors degree in Real Estate, Business, or related field preferred.
  • Must reside in New Jersey ; some travel for site visits may be required.
